Well, this depends on how you play it. In most games I've played
in, the smartgunlink had a sort of dedicated display link that could
project the necessary data. The hardware is already there to project the
cross-hairs anyway, so it's not a great leap to include the other stuff
as well.
It does *not* give you full display link capabilities, though.
It's kind of like the dedicated chipjack for the orientation system.
